What are the wind conditions in Tenerife?

In autumn/winter season trade winds stabilise and blow from NE with average strength 10-15 knots.

Often the wind is 20 knots or stronger at our spot. Even with 15 knots wind the waves build up quite big and long.

What to wear while dinghy sailing?

Buoyancy aids are obligatory and are included in charter price. 

Sigma Active Ocean
We advise to wear a wetsuit, or some light, quickly drying clothing. A windbreaker is usually
a good idea. A hat, sunglasses and sunscreen is a must. If you don’t have proffesional dinghy
sailing shoes- you can use trainers with rubber, not slippery soles. Shoes used for
windsurfing or surfing are just fine.

We provide harnesses.

Other dinghies
A wetsuit is necessary. You will also need a hat, saunglasses, sailing gloves, sailing shoes and
sunscreen.

You can rent wetsuit and boots from us, for our courses they are included in the price.

What are the accommodation options close to the marina?

There are plenty of hotels, apartments, villas near the marina. You can use platforms such as Booking.com or Airbnb.com and search for areas: Golf del Sur, Amarilla Golf, Los Abrigos.

If you are a low budget traveller you can stay in one of the nearby hostels in Los Abrigos, El Medano, Costa del Silencio or Las Galletas. You might need a bicycle to commute to Amarilla. 

Another option is to rent a van, which you can park near the marina.
